Readability and Practical Usage Tips
While Bee Mind is expressive, readability remains paramount in business communications. Not every word needs to be in a script font. In fact, overusing decorative typefaces can reduce legibility, especially on small product labels or mobile screens. The best practice is to use Bee Mind strategically as a display font or headline typeface. Reserve simpler, highly readable fonts for body text, such as detailed product descriptions or terms and conditions.
When designing for different mediums, keep the context in mind. On a large-format poster or a website hero banner, the intricate details of Bee Mind will be appreciated. However, if you are printing tiny text on a cosmetic bottle, ensure the font size is large enough to be legible. Always test your designs in black and white first to check contrast and hierarchy before adding colors. This simple step ensures that your message is clear regardless of the medium.
Effective Font Pairing Strategies
One of the most common mistakes new entrepreneurs make is trying to let a single font do all the work. To create a balanced and professional look, pair Bee Mind with a complementary typeface. Since Bee Mind is a dynamic handwritten font, it benefits from stability. A clean sans serif font is an ideal partner, providing a modern contrast that grounds the whimsical nature of the script. This combination is particularly effective for tech startups, modern boutiques, or service providers who want to appear both creative and efficient.
Alternatively, pairing Bee Mind with a classic serif font can evoke a sense of tradition and elegance. This works wonderfully for luxury brands, wedding planners, or high-end cafes. The key is to maintain a clear distinction between the two fonts. Let Bee Mind handle the emotional appeal and branding, while the supporting font handles the informational heavy lifting. This font pairing strategy ensures your brand looks sophisticated rather than cluttered.
Licensing and Commercial Use
As a business owner, it is crucial to respect intellectual property rights. While Bee Mind may be available as a freebie for personal use, commercial usage often requires a separate license. Before applying this font to products you sell, merchandise, client work, or digital downloads, always check the specific licensing agreement provided by the type designer. Using a commercial font correctly protects your business from legal issues and supports the creators who make these design tools possible. Many designers offer affordable commercial licenses that allow you to use the font across multiple projects, making it a cost-effective addition to your design assets.
